Top Reasons to Go to Lanai
Seclusion and serenity: Lanai is small: local motion is slow motion. Get into the spirit and go home rested instead of exhausted.
Garden of the Gods: Walk amid the eerie red-rock spires that Hawaiians believe to be a sacred spot. The ocean views are magnificent, too; sunset is a good time to visit.
A dive at Cathedrals: Explore underwater pinnacle formations and mysterious caverns illuminated by shimmering rays of light.
Dole Park: Hang out in the shade of the Cook pines in Lanai City and talk story with the locals for a taste of old-time Hawaii.
Hit the water at Hulopoe Beach: This beach may have it all: good swimming, a shady park for perfect picnicking, great reefs for snorkeling, and sometimes plenty of spinner dolphins.
